Common Issues with Visa Gift Cards and Solutions

Using Visa gift cards can be an excellent way for student freelancers to manage finances and make purchases, but there are common challenges that may arise. One prevalent issue is the perception that Visa gift cards always act like debit or credit cards. However, some online platforms may not accept them if the card does not have a billing address associated with it. To help mitigate this problem, it’s important to register your card online if that option is available. This way, you can ensure it has a designated billing address that matches your online accounts, improving acceptance rates during checkout.

Another common challenge involves insufficient funds on the card. If your purchase total exceeds the amount available on the card, the transaction may decline. Students can address this by checking their balance regularly and being mindful of splitting larger transactions into two payments if necessary. Many online retailers provide the option to apply multiple payment methods. Keep a notes app or physical notebook handy to track transactions and balances, ensuring you’re always aware of how much you have available.

Security is another significant concern. Students may fear fraud or loss of funds, especially with online purchases. To combat these issues, use secure websites (look for HTTPS in the URL) when entering card information, and never share your card details via email or messaging apps. Additionally, most card issuers provide a mobile app or web portal to monitor transactions and report any suspicious activities immediately. It’s critical to remain proactive in safeguarding your financial information.

Finally, being aware of the fees associated with Visa gift cards can prevent unexpected charges that could impact your budgeting. Look out for activation fees, monthly maintenance fees, or transaction fees which might reduce your available balance. Familiarize yourself with the terms and conditions of your gift card and shop around for cards with minimal fees, so that you can maximize your usable funds for freelance needs. Alternatives to Visa Gift Cards for Freelancers

Exploring alternative methods for managing finances can empower student freelancers, providing a more flexible and tailored approach to meet their unique needs. Visa gift cards, while convenient, may not always serve effectively where billing addresses or transaction limits become hurdles. Fortunately, there are various other options available that offer similar benefits without the potential complications associated with gift cards.

Reloadable Prepaid Debit Cards

Reloadable prepaid debit cards are an excellent alternative. These cards function much like traditional debit cards but are not linked to a bank account. Students can load funds onto these cards as needed, allowing for controlled spending and easy online purchases. Many prepaid cards, such as those offered by Green Dot or NetSpend, allow you to manage your funds online and set limits to avoid overspending. Plus, they often come with features like direct deposit for freelance earnings, providing an even greater level of financial flexibility.

Online Payment Services

Another invaluable resource is online payment services such as PayPal, Venmo, or Cash App. These platforms not only allow for quick money transfers but also enable students to make purchases at various online stores that accept these payment methods. Setting up an account is quick and straightforward, and these services can also serve as a buffer between your bank account and various online transactions, enhancing security. Additionally, they often come with cash-back offers or rewards for transactions, giving students more bang for their buck.

Virtual Bank Accounts

A more modern approach is a virtual bank account, which provides many of the traditional banking services but operates entirely online. Services like Chime or Ally offer virtual accounts with low fees and no minimum balance requirements. Students can earn interest on their balances and have access to features such as budgeting tools and mobile deposits. This option combines convenience with the benefits of a traditional bank account, making it easy to manage finances efficiently while juggling studies and freelancing jobs.

Understanding Fees Associated with Visa Gift Cards

In the ever-evolving landscape of online payments, understanding the fees associated with Visa gift cards is crucial, especially for student freelancers who often rely on these financial tools for their projects. While these gift cards offer convenience and flexibility, they can come with a few hidden costs that could impact your budget if you are not aware of them.

One of the primary fees to watch out for is the purchase fee. Typically, when buying a Visa gift card, retailers may charge an upfront fee that can range from $3 to $7, depending on the card’s value and the retailer’s policy. For students on a tight budget, this fee can seem like an unnecessary expense, so it’s wise to compare different retailers before making a purchase. Additionally, some retail outlets may offer promotional deals that waive this fee, offering a more budget-friendly option.

Activation and Maintenance Fees

Many Visa gift cards also come with activation fees that are charged at the time of purchase. Moreover, if you’re not using your card frequently, consider the possibility of a maintenance or inactivity fee. This fee is usually deducted from the balance after a specific period of inactivity, potentially eroding your card’s value. To avoid these charges, make a conscious effort to utilize your gift card within the designated timeframe, and keep track of your spending.

Foreign Transaction and Reloading Fees

If you plan on using your Visa gift card for international purchases, be prepared for foreign transaction fees, which can add an additional 3% to 5% to your transaction total. This is particularly relevant for student freelancers who may be working with international clients or suppliers. Additionally, some Visa gift cards may allow for reloading funds; however, this service can also carry fees. Before attempting to reload your card, review the terms to understand any associated costs.

Frequently asked questions

Q: What types of Visa gift cards can student freelancers use online?
A: Student freelancers can use Visa prepaid cards that are reloadable and recognized at any merchant accepting Visa debit. Options include digital Visa gift cards available through various online platforms, which can be conveniently used for online purchases related to freelancing.

Q: Are there specific Visa gift cards designed for students working freelance?
A: While there aren’t Visa gift cards specifically branded for students, any general Visa prepaid or gift card can be effectively used by student freelancers. These cards allow flexibility in online transactions for freelance services and materials.

Q: How do I find Visa gift cards that do not expire?
A: Most Visa gift cards do not have an expiration date for the funds; however, it’s essential to review the terms provided by the card issuer. For student use, opt for cards that clearly state no fees for inactivity to maximize usability.

Q: Can student freelancers use Visa gift cards on freelance platforms?
A: Yes, many freelance platforms accept Visa gift cards for payment. Ensure the card has a sufficient balance and that it is registered for online use to avoid transaction issues.

Q: How do I redeem a Visa gift card for an online purchase as a student?
A: To redeem a Visa gift card online, enter the card number, expiration date, and security code during the checkout process. Treat it like a regular credit card, ensuring enough balance is available for the total purchase.

Q: What are the fees associated with Visa gift cards for freelancers?
A: Fees may vary by issuer but can include activation fees and monthly maintenance fees. Choose cards with minimal or no fees to maximize benefits for freelance work.

Q: Can I reload my Visa gift card as a student freelancer?
A: Yes, certain Visa prepaid cards are reloadable, allowing you to add funds as necessary. This feature is ideal for student freelancers who may require ongoing financing for various freelance expenses.
